Apache Camel Kafka Spring Boot Example / Maven users can add the following dependency in the pom.xml file.. Apache camel spring boot examples. The concurrentkafkalistenercontainerfactory and kafkamessagelistenercontainer beans are also. Once you have a spring boot project and a demo camel working inside. Apache kafka is the widely used tool to implement asynchronous communication in microservices based architecture. Configure kafka consume and producer route.
With this module, we can take full advantage of spring our test project implements one simple camel route which monitors a folder for new files. Check out apache camel kafka spring integration. Use kafkatemplate to send please follow this guide to setup kafka on your machine. Configure kafka broker instance in application.yaml. The kafka configuration is controlled by the configuration properties with the.
But when working with springboot, camel searches springboot context first then injects found objects from there to its camelcontext, like routebuilder in our example. Use kafkatemplate to send please follow this guide to setup kafka on your machine. I will be showing you some examples of camel activemq so you need to add the following dependencies: Spring boot allows for easy, convention based, configuration, so googling getting started with spring boot and camel would get you to examples. This article is about spring boot and apache kafka integration with sample consumer and producer example.we have discussed about kafkatemplate, @kafkalistener and @sendto provided by spring boot. I used camelspringtestsupport class in my unit test. Apache camel provides a module which integrates nicely into spring boot: Will present basics of apache kafka for developers and show how to develop and test applications with use of apache camel and spring boot with kafka in.
When using kafka with spring boot make sure to use the following maven dependency to have support for auto configuration the option is a org.apache.camel.component.kafka.serde.kafkaheaderdeserializer type.
It provides out of the box support for the most popular eips (enterprise integration patterns). I will be showing you some examples of camel activemq so you need to add the following dependencies: By dhiraj, last updated on: For example if you work on windows, you can install scoop. Configure kafka broker instance in application.yaml. Apache camel provides a module which integrates nicely into spring boot: Locate the pom.xml file in the root directory of your app; Create spring boot kafka example. If you have a few years of experience in the java ecosystem, and you're interested in sharing that experience with the community (and getting paid for your work of course), have a look at the write for us page. We are creating a maven based spring boot application, so your machine should have. Camel can also work seamlessly with spring boot, and that. Apache camel is a popular open source integration framework that can work with almost any message brokers like kafka, activemq, rabbitmq etc. Home » spring framework » spring kafka » spring kafka and spring boot configuration example.
Spring boot allows for easy, convention based, configuration, so googling getting started with spring boot and camel would get you to examples. Let's get started on the project now. Spring boot version 2.0 or greater is required to complete the steps in this article. Configure kafka broker instance in application.yaml. Check out apache camel kafka spring integration.
The concurrentkafkalistenercontainerfactory and kafkamessagelistenercontainer beans are also. Spring boot version 2.0 or greater is required to complete the steps in this article. With this module, we can take full advantage of spring our test project implements one simple camel route which monitors a folder for new files. By dhiraj, last updated on: Spring is the inversion of controller framework. Camel can also work seamlessly with spring boot, and that. But when working with springboot, camel searches springboot context first then injects found objects from there to its camelcontext, like routebuilder in our example. I used camelspringtestsupport class in my unit test.
By dhiraj, last updated on:
Spring boot is a framework that allows me to go through my development process much faster and easier than before. Create spring boot kafka example. Use kafkatemplate to send please follow this guide to setup kafka on your machine. The concurrentkafkalistenercontainerfactory and kafkamessagelistenercontainer beans are also. Home » spring framework » spring kafka » spring kafka and spring boot configuration example. This article is about spring boot and apache kafka integration with sample consumer and producer example.we have discussed about kafkatemplate, @kafkalistener and @sendto provided by spring boot. The kafka configuration is controlled by the configuration properties with the. The apache camel spring testing page describes three approaches for testing spring with camel. Configure your spring boot app to use the spring cloud kafka stream and azure event hub starters. Will present basics of apache kafka for developers and show how to develop and test applications with use of apache camel and spring boot with kafka in. Spring boot allows for easy, convention based, configuration, so googling getting started with spring boot and camel would get you to examples. Spring boot does most of the configuration automatically, so we can focus on building the listeners and producing the messages. Spring is the inversion of controller framework.
Configure your spring boot app to use the spring cloud kafka stream and azure event hub starters. Use kafkatemplate to send please follow this guide to setup kafka on your machine. Once you have a spring boot project and a demo camel working inside. Apache camel is a popular open source integration framework that can work with almost any message brokers like kafka, activemq, rabbitmq etc. Spring boot allows for easy, convention based, configuration, so googling getting started with spring boot and camel would get you to examples.
Will present basics of apache kafka for developers and show how to develop and test applications with use of apache camel and spring boot with kafka in. Setting up kafka consumer configuration. Apache kafka is a genuinely likable name in the software industry; I will be showing you some examples of camel activemq so you need to add the following dependencies: So, for example, when the file name contains cat, the file. Locate the pom.xml file in the root directory of your app; Camel can also work seamlessly with spring boot, and that. For example if you work on windows, you can install scoop.
Spring boot version 2.0 or greater is required to complete the steps in this article.
Let's get started on the project now. By dhiraj, last updated on: Setting up kafka consumer configuration. But when working with springboot, camel searches springboot context first then injects found objects from there to its camelcontext, like routebuilder in our example. The apache camel spring testing page describes three approaches for testing spring with camel. I will be showing you some examples of camel activemq so you need to add the following dependencies: In this article, we saw how to integrate apache camel with spring boot.we briefly describe what is apache camel, how to. When using kafka with spring boot make sure to use the following maven dependency to have support for auto configuration the option is a org.apache.camel.component.kafka.serde.kafkaheaderdeserializer type. Spring boot allows for easy, convention based, configuration, so googling getting started with spring boot and camel would get you to examples. The concurrentkafkalistenercontainerfactory and kafkamessagelistenercontainer beans are also. Apache kafka is the widely used tool to implement asynchronous communication in microservices based architecture. Home » spring framework » spring kafka » spring kafka and spring boot configuration example. So, for example, when the file name contains cat, the file.